Transaction 39262cd91bf32e1777a6443a035d55847252da28eb7372af3d43bdbb934b0233
1 Input
1 Output
-
39262cd91bf32e1777a6443a035d55847252da28eb7372af3d43bdbb934b0233:0
- value
- 19382752
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 651501a29910be45b08d5f2d6006d56ebcd6ff68 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ADUQvcB9ocw9gSJRpgRt1rid8RnLVq9rX